WebFeb 20, 2024 · 1. First-time home buyers' tax credit. If you just bought your first home last year, or if you haven't lived in a home owned by you or your spouse in the last four years, then you might qualify for the First-Time Home Buyers' Tax Credit (HBTC) of $5,000, which adds $750 to your tax refund. The $5,000 can be split between the house owners as long as the total amount claimed on all tax returns doesn’t exceed $5,000. The credit is claimed on line 31270 on your income tax and benefits return (previously line 369).

Learn more about CRA. … WebNov 14, 2024 · If you’re a co-owner, you must determine if a partnership exists. Co-ownership in itself doesn’t constitute a partnership, so check applicable laws for your territory or province, or consult CRA. WebIf you are married or living common-law. You could get $500 if your adjusted family net income for the previous year was $45,000 or less. If your income is over $45,000, your grant will be reduced by 3.33% of your income over $45,000. You do not qualify for the grant if your adjusted family net income is $60,000 or more. WebMar 30, 2024 · Plus, your loved ones will face the issue of double taxation. Tax authorities will consider your loved ones to have actually purchased the property for $1, so whenever they resell the $200,000 property, your children will be taxed on a $199,999 capital gain ($200,000 minus $1). 2.

WebVisit the First-Time Home Buyer Incentive for more detail. The Home Buyers’ Amount offers a $5,000 non-refundable income tax credit amount on a qualifying home acquired during the year. For an eligible individual, the credit will provide up to $750 in federal tax relief. Go to the Home Buyers’ Amount webpage to see if you are eligible. WebSep 19, 2011 · Loss of control and co-owner disputes. One of the biggest disadvantages of transfer to joint ownership is the loss of control of the property by the original owner – leading to a host of possible problems. In the case of a bank account, the new joint owner can drain the funds or otherwise misuse them if he or she has sole signing authority ...
